Pre-purchase question: Can i use anchors to link to info on the same page?

Any answer? I need to propose this to a client…

Hello, If you mean that you have sections in the page and each section has an ID, then you can use that anchor as a link for states in the map dashboard, like this (#california). so when someone clicks a state the page will jump to the corresponding section.

Notes:
1. creating sections with IDs is out of the map plugin scope.
2. I suggest that you take a look at the modal window option, there you can add as much information as you want in the modal window which opens when someone clicks a state, please watch this video for more details.

To hide the small state callouts I had to hack the map.php plugin file using the technique shown in the demo video. So I have to re-hack with each plugin update? Why no setting in the UI to hide the callouts, with the custom color that I assigned to the map background—if the callouts must be ‘covered’ rather than removed altogether.

I find it strange this basic control isn’t programmed, but requires a user hack.

Thanks very much for your feedback. I completely understand your concern but please note that the actual map graphics is preset as SVG shapes so hiding or removing part of a state would normally require editing the map SVG graphics but we added this simple trick to give our customers a quick and easy way to hide those callout boxes.

We understand that we can add many new useful options in the UI but on the other hand we need to keep the map dashboard as simple as possible so we have to weigh the importance of each feature for all customers.

Fortunately, you managed to apply that trick even without contacting us, and don’t worry we don’t release major updates very frequently (unless we have big new feature) so you won’t need to update the plugin very frequently.
